SomeOtherGuy
10-15-17, 22:17
I just don't get the fascination with FDE. ODG just works better than FDE east of the Mississippi as it does west.

Not everywhere. Lots of the midwest has relatively thin, brown forests and lots of grasslands that aren't really ODG. And in my area plants only have green vegetation for about 5 months of the year, the rest of the year is brown or snow. I suppose you could have three rifles to cover the three colors, or re-paint your rifle four times a year (brown is both fall and spring), but various shades of tan work well enough year round even if not perfectly ideal at any one time.


FDE is great if you live anywhere it gets hot during the summer. My FDE holsters, pistol frames/slides stay much cooler when sitting in the sun than my black stuff.

This too. A day in the summer sun at a rifle match will make this obvious, even in relatively mild climates.
